Japanese COURSE TYPES

What type of Japanese course are you looking for?

General

General Japanese courses

General Japanese courses are for adults who want to improve their speaking, listening, reading, and writing skills in Japanese. Most general Japanese courses are for adults age 16 and up. 2 - 48 week courses available. Most courses average 30 classes per week.

Test preparation

Japanese test preparation courses

Japanese test preparation courses are for students who want to prepare for Japanese proficiency tests to improve job prospects or gain admission into a university.

Business

Business Japanese courses

One-to-one business Japanese lessons are for business executives and professionals who want to learn Japanese as quickly as possible with customized lessons and a private Japanese teacher.

Professional

Professional Japanese courses

Professional Japanese courses are for professionals who want to study Japanese in a specific area, such as business, medicine, law, aviation, and hospitality.

Specialty

Specialty Japanese courses

Specialty Japanese courses are for those who want to study Japanese and take part in activities, such as sports, arts, food, and more.
